Honestly, hard to argue with that. The geopolitical risk index we follow hit 297 this month — up 176 points in one month. That kind of spike has a way of eating macro tailwinds for breakfast.

But a few things are quietly moving in the background. M2 expanded over 1% in four weeks, dollar weakened, VIX dropped. Historically those three together have shown up about four weeks before Bitcoin moves. Not a green light — more like the light is thinking about turning.

Cautious makes sense right now. I'd just keep one eye on M2. That's been the most reliable early signal in the data. If it keeps expanding and GPR starts cooling, the bear case gets harder to hold.
